当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

文件 块 对象 存储,深入解析文件块对象存储,原理、挑战与未来发展趋势

文件 块 对象 存储,深入解析文件块对象存储,原理、挑战与未来发展趋势

文件块对象存储是一种高效的数据存储方式,通过将文件分割成块,并使用对象存储技术进行管理,本文深入解析了其原理,分析了面临的挑战,并展望了未来发展趋势。...

文件块对象存储是一种高效的数据存储方式,通过将文件分割成块,并使用对象存储技术进行管理,本文深入解析了其原理,分析了面临的挑战,并展望了未来发展趋势。

随着大数据时代的到来,数据量呈爆炸式增长,传统的文件存储方式已无法满足日益增长的数据存储需求,文件块对象存储作为一种新兴的存储技术,凭借其高效、可靠、可扩展等优势,逐渐成为存储领域的研究热点,本文将从文件块对象存储的原理、挑战以及未来发展趋势等方面进行深入探讨。

文件块对象存储原理

文件块对象存储概念

文件 块 对象 存储,深入解析文件块对象存储,原理、挑战与未来发展趋势

图片来源于网络,如有侵权联系删除

文件块对象存储是一种基于对象存储的文件存储技术,它将文件划分为多个小块,并以块为单位进行存储,每个块包含文件的一部分数据,同时具有唯一的标识符,通过这些标识符,可以实现对文件的快速检索和访问。

文件块对象存储架构

文件块对象存储架构主要包括以下几个部分:

(1)客户端:负责向存储系统发送读写请求,并接收存储系统返回的数据。

(2)元数据服务器:负责管理存储系统的元数据,如文件块信息、存储节点信息等。

(3)存储节点:负责存储文件块数据,并响应客户端的读写请求。

(4)数据副本:为了提高数据可靠性,文件块对象存储通常采用数据副本机制,将文件块数据存储在多个存储节点上。

文件块对象存储工作流程

(1)客户端向元数据服务器发送文件存储请求,元数据服务器根据请求信息生成文件块信息。

(2)元数据服务器将文件块信息发送给存储节点,存储节点根据文件块信息存储文件块数据。

(3)客户端向存储节点发送文件读取请求,存储节点根据文件块信息返回文件块数据。

(4)客户端将多个文件块数据拼接成完整的文件。

文件块对象存储挑战

数据可靠性

文件块对象存储系统需要保证数据可靠性,防止数据丢失,数据副本机制虽然可以提高数据可靠性,但也会增加存储成本。

存储性能

随着数据量的增加,文件块对象存储系统的存储性能会受到影响,如何提高存储性能,成为亟待解决的问题。

空间利用率

文件块对象存储系统需要合理利用存储空间,避免空间浪费,如何提高空间利用率,是存储系统设计的重要目标。

安全性

文件块对象存储系统需要保证数据安全,防止数据泄露和篡改,如何提高安全性,是存储系统设计的关键。

文件块对象存储未来发展趋势

文件 块 对象 存储,深入解析文件块对象存储,原理、挑战与未来发展趋势

图片来源于网络,如有侵权联系删除

存储性能优化

随着存储需求的不断增长,文件块对象存储系统需要进一步提高存储性能,存储性能优化可以从以下几个方面进行:

(1)采用更高效的存储协议,如NVM Express(NVMe)。

(2)优化存储节点架构,提高数据传输效率。

(3)引入分布式存储技术,实现数据负载均衡。

数据可靠性提升

为了提高数据可靠性,文件块对象存储系统可以从以下几个方面进行改进:

(1)采用更可靠的数据副本机制,如纠错码。

(2)引入数据压缩技术,降低存储空间占用。

(3)优化存储节点硬件,提高数据存储可靠性。

空间利用率提高

为了提高空间利用率,文件块对象存储系统可以从以下几个方面进行改进:

(1)采用智能存储策略,如热数据缓存。

(2)引入数据去重技术,减少存储空间占用。

(3)优化存储节点硬件,提高存储密度。

安全性增强

为了增强安全性,文件块对象存储系统可以从以下几个方面进行改进:

(1)采用更严格的数据加密技术,防止数据泄露和篡改。

(2)引入访问控制机制,限制非法访问。

(3)优化存储节点硬件,提高安全性。

文件块对象存储作为一种新兴的存储技术,具有高效、可靠、可扩展等优势,随着大数据时代的到来,文件块对象存储技术将得到广泛应用,本文从文件块对象存储的原理、挑战以及未来发展趋势等方面进行了深入探讨,旨在为相关领域的研究和开发提供参考。

黑狐家游戏

发表评论

最新文章